Overview of the Volvo FH Aero 500 GNL
The Volvo FH Aero 500 GNL is a tractor unit that has garnered attention for its efficient use of gas as a fuel source. It boasts a robust 500 horsepower engine, which is an increase of 40 horsepower compared to its predecessor. This enhancement is largely due to improved software in the engine management system, rather than fundamental hardware changes.
Designed primarily for long-distance use, this truck features a spacious cabin that ensures comfort during extended journeys. The increased torque of 2,500 Nm is particularly beneficial, providing the necessary power to tackle challenging terrains and heavy loads without strain.
Understanding the Engine Technology
What sets the FH Aero 500 apart from traditional diesel trucks is its unique engine cycle that utilizes a dual-fuel system. Here’s how it works:
- The primary fuel is natural gas, making up approximately 90-95% of the fuel mix.
- Diesel is used in smaller quantities (5-10%) solely to initiate combustion.
- Two independent injection systems ensure precise fuel delivery, enhancing efficiency.
- AdBlue is incorporated to reduce emissions from the small amount of diesel consumed.
This innovative approach not only maintains performance but also significantly reduces environmental impact, achieving around 20% less emissions compared to diesel-only trucks. If biogas is used, this reduction can soar to nearly 90%.
Performance and Driving Experience
During our testing, we found that the FH Aero 500 offers a driving experience comparable to traditional diesel trucks, with a notable reduction in noise levels. The incorporation of a reliable engine brake is a crucial feature, as gas engines typically have lower compression ratios that can affect braking efficiency.
Some highlights of the driving performance include:
- Efficient fuel consumption, with a notable reduction in costs for long trips.
- Enhanced aerodynamics thanks to the sleek design and a longer front section, improving fuel efficiency.
- A digital mirror system that contributes to both aerodynamics and safety.
The digital mirror system, known as the Volvo CMS (Camera Monitor System), is a significant advancement in safety and efficiency. However, traditionalists can opt for conventional mirrors if they prefer.
Cabin Features and Comfort
Inside the cabin, Volvo continues to prioritize driver comfort and ergonomics. The interior may not have seen radical changes compared to previous models, but it remains one of the most comfortable in the market. Features include:
- Upgraded multimedia controls with an intuitive interface.
- Ergonomically designed seating for long-haul comfort.
- High-quality materials that enhance the driving experience.
With a focus on reducing cabin noise, the FH Aero 500 delivers a smooth ride, making long distances more manageable for drivers.
Cost Efficiency and Environmental Impact
When evaluating the cost of operating the FH Aero 500, we found substantial savings. Based on mid-June fuel prices, the cost per 100 kilometers was as follows:
Fuel Type | Cost per 100 km |
---|---|
Gas (GNL) | €29.51 |
Diesel | €42.57 |
This comparison highlights the significant financial benefits of using GNL over diesel. Additionally, the integration of Volvo Connect provides fleet managers with valuable data insights, enabling them to monitor fuel consumption, driver behavior, and overall efficiency.
Comparative Analysis: Volvo vs. Scania
When considering the competition, many fleet operators often compare Volvo and Scania trucks for their performance, reliability, and cost-effectiveness. Both brands have their strengths, but here are some key differences:
- **Volvo** focuses heavily on sustainability and innovative technology, especially with its GNL models.
- **Scania** is renowned for its powerful engines and robust build quality, catering to heavy-duty operations.
- Volvo's cabin design emphasizes driver comfort and high-tech features, while Scania offers a more traditional approach.
Ultimately, the choice between the two may depend on specific operational needs and preferences for technology versus traditional driving experiences.
